De sancto Fabiano

Sein Fabian bi olde dauwe god man was inou
At Rome he ladde holy lif and to alle godnesse drou
So þat as oure Louerd it wolde þe pope of Rome was ded
Hy byspeke to cheose anoþer as þe comun nom hor red
Hy cride on oure Louerd niȝt and day þat he sende hom in þe place

Som toknynge wo it miȝte be[o] for his holy grace
Þo com þer out of heuene a wiȝt coluer fle[o] adoun
And aliȝte uppon sein Fabian anouwarde þe croun
Þo þis toknynge was icome glad hy were echon
Hy nome him up as oure Louerd it wolde & made him pope anon
Þo he was pope þis holyman he huld up mid al is miȝte
Þe riȝte byleue of Cristendom and Holy Churches riȝte
So þat þe luþer Decyous þat emperor was þo
Isey þe folk to Cristendom þoru þis holyman go
He þoȝte anon & swor is oþ þat þare ne ssolde namo
He let nyme þis holiman and dude hym pine and wo
And suþþe he let smite of is heued after al is oþer pine
And þus sein Fabian þe pope broȝte is lif to fine
Þis was þe þritteþe ȝer þat he hadde pope ybe[o]
And to hondred ȝer it was ek and vifty and þre[o]
After þat oure swete Louerd an eorþe for us com
Þat sein Fabian þis holyman þolede martirdom
And wende to þe ioie of heuene þat last wiþoute ende
Nou God for þe loue of him us alle þuder sende
